With the introduction of iOS 18, Apple has made a significant improvement in the area of password management: the new standalone Passwords app. This app makes it easier than ever to securely store, manage, and autofill passwords and login information. In this article, you'll learn all about the new features of the iOS 18 Passwords app and how it can help you manage your login information efficiently and securely.
Managing passwords has always been an important aspect of digital security. iCloud Keychain already allowed you to save login information and sync it across your Apple devices. However, accessing these passwords was a bit cumbersome in previous versions of iOS, as they were hidden in the depths of the Settings app. With the new Passwords app, Apple has significantly improved the layout and usability, and now offers you a central place to store your login information.
Easy management in the passwords app
After updating to iOS 18, iPadOS 18 and macOS 15, the Passwords app is automatically installed on your device. It offers a clear layout that allows you to quickly access your saved passwords. There is a search bar at the top of the app that allows you to easily find specific login details. You can manage passwords, passkeys, Wi-Fi passwords and two-factor authentication codes and also restore deleted login details in a separate folder or delete them permanently.
The app is clearly structured and offers the following functions:
- AutoFill: Enabling AutoFill will automatically fill in your login information in Safari or other apps.
- Two-factor authentication (2FA): You can create and save 2FA codes directly in the app.
- Passkeys: With iOS 18, you can switch to more secure passkeys, which are cryptographically protected, unlike traditional passwords.
Add and Manage Passwords
Adding new login details is easy. Just tap the "+" symbol in the app and it will suggest a secure password. All you have to do is enter the name of the website and your username. If you want to change an existing password or add new information, search for the relevant login and select the "Edit" option. Here you can add notes, update passwords or enter a new verification code.
Security and Alerts
A highlight of the Passwords app in iOS 18 is the improved security overview. The app detects insecure passwords that have been used multiple times or are at risk due to data leaks. You receive warning messages in a separate area and can go directly to the respective website with one click to change your password.
password sharing with friends and family
Another useful feature is the ability to share passwords with trusted contacts. Create groups for friends or family and share selected passwords. This sharing is done either via AirDrop or through the group function in the app.
Synchronization via iCloud and cross-platform access
With iCloud Keychain, your passwords are securely synced between all your Apple devices, meaning you can access the same login information on an iPhone, iPad, or Mac. Also new in iOS 18 is the ability to use passwords on a Windows PC by using iTunes integration.
Passkeys: The Future of Logins
Passkeys are a modern and more secure alternative to passwords. They are based on a cryptographic key pair that stores a public key on the server and a private key on your device. Unlike traditional passwords, private keys always stay on your device and are not transmitted, which reduces the risk of phishing. Apple has introduced passkeys as standard for iOS 18, and you can check in the Passwords app whether a website supports this option.
Importing and exporting passwords
Although the ability to import passwords from other services like 1Password or LastPass is not yet implemented, Apple has announced that it will provide this feature in future updates. This means that in the near future, you will be able to manage all your login information centrally in the Passwords app.
